Brad Marchand has fit like a glove alongside Anton Lundell and Eetu Luostarinen on the Florida Panthers' third line.
That line completely dominated Tampa Bay's and Toronto's depth units over the first two rounds of the playoffs, spending a ton of time on the front foot while piling up the goals.
They helped the Panthers control 60% of the expected goal share and 57% of the scoring chances thus far.
That has led to a ton of success on the scoreboard, with Marchand & Co. up a whopping 10-2 in the goal department.
Marchand has gotten better as the playoffs have progressed after hitting the scoresheet only once over the first three games of Florida’s run. He has since picked up at least one point in seven of the last nine and scored in two of the last three games on the road.
Paul Maurice tends to give this line plenty of run against top lines when playing in Florida. They have faced easier matchups on the road and taken full advantage, with Marchand recording nine points over a five-game point streak away from home.
Marchand and this dominant third line will be tough for the Carolina Hurricanes to slow down, especially when using their best personnel against the Aleksander Barkov and Matthew Tkachuk lines.
Don’t be surprised if Marchand’s road success continues and he finds the back of the net once again.

Marchand is a shooting machine against the Hurricanes. For whatever reason, he always seems to pile up the shots vs. a team that generally gives up very little.
He has recorded at least two shots in 12 of the last 14 games against Carolina, including seven straight on the road.
Taking matters a step further, Marchand has generated three shots or more in five of the last six in Carolina. He owns a remarkable track record against the Hurricanes and is worth backing while he’s still red hot.
